Stephen Curry, serving as the unofficial host of the NBA's All-Star weekend, participated in several events across the Bay Area, including a gym restoration ceremony at Oakland's McClymonds High and a morning practice at Oakland Arena. Reflecting on his journey with the Warriors, he highlighted the balance between celebrating his past achievements and remaining focused on future goals. During the weekend, Curry expressed his belief in his continued capabilities as a player, sharing a pop culture reference to emphasize the importance of staying grounded amidst celebrations.
This is a cool celebration, a ceremony of being in this arena, Curry said after the workout in Oakland, in the building where he won three of his four NBA championships.
I made a reference to Coming to America 2', where they had, like, the live funeral thing, said Curry, 36. Everybody's celebrating you, but you're still there, witnessing it.
